Michael Haneke is a unique filmmaking artist. Anyone familiar with his work knows he is less interested in coming up with a solution than he is in seeing what his characters will do under certain circumstances.
And Cache is a rather perfect example of a Haneke film. A married couple find a tape of their house. What are they being filmed? Great, yet simple, opening credits.
